This European Standard gives guidance on methods for handling, inactivating and testing of waste containing organisms arising from biotechnology laboratory activities and processes. It is concerned with methods to reduce the risks arising from exposure to waste derived from laboratory-scale activities which contains organisms hazardous or potentially hazardous to humans, animals, plants or the environment.
